Output 66fec8ddfffd3335f5c60ea037409d415b7e86b52f4551fcf244eaf2d407123c:1

value
9729064
script pubkey
OP_0 OP_PUSHBYTES_20 d3262ecf6acd905f2b44fdf44ae4fbd35821ee58
address
ltc1q6vnzanm2ekg9726ylh6y4e8m6dvzrmjcs97zh2
transaction
66fec8ddfffd3335f5c60ea037409d415b7e86b52f4551fcf244eaf2d407123c
spent
true